【摘要】 目的:制备炎症显像剂99mTc-环丙沙星,并研究其在体内分布及炎症显像的方法,同时就此药物的体内分布特点进行分析,以评价其应用于临床的可行性。方法:研究标记物99mTc-环丙沙星的稳定性、小白鼠炎症模型体内分布并进行体外显像。结果:99mTc-环丙沙星标记率大于90%,室温下6h内化合物的放化纯稳定。小白鼠炎症组织与正常组织的放射性比值高,注射后1、4、6h,炎症组织与对侧正常组织比值分别为3.48、4.30、4.17。99mTc-环丙沙星主要由肝脏代谢、经肾脏排泄,血液清除较快。结论:99mTc-环丙沙星是一种灵敏度及特异性均高的炎症灶显像剂,且制备方法简单、方便。

【Abstract】 Objective: To prepare 99mTc-Ciprofloxacin(CPF), an inflammation tracer, and obtain the information about its biodistribution and scintigraphy in mice model, and assess its feasibility of clinical application. Methods: The stability of 99mTc-CPF, its biodistribution in mice model were studied, and 99mTc-CPF scintigraphy in mice model of inflammation was also performed. Results: The labelling rate of 99mTc-CPF was over 90%. 99mTc-Ciprotech was stable within 6 hours at room temperature. The inflammatory tissue/normal tissue were 3.48, 4.30 and 4.17 at 1, 4, 6 hour after injection respectively. The radioactivity clearance mainly occurred in the liver and kidney, and the clearance from blood was rapid. Conclusion: 99mTc-CPF is a specific and sensitive radiophamiaceutical agent for scintigraphy of inflammatory lesions, and it is easy to prepare.
